How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Decoto?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Decoto Studio Apartments | $2,986 | $2,025 | $4,400 |
Decoto 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,776 | $1,995 | $5,004 |
Decoto 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,306 | $2,000 | $8,113 |
Decoto 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,940 | $3,295 | $4,585 |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
